Why should iDVD only work with internal SuperDrive. Does it only recognize ATAPI bus. Does Pioneer sell internal (IDE/ATAPI) model? That should be the same thing Apple buys OEM.
As for iDVD working in other systems, it need Velocity Engine (AltiVec) and will NEVER work with iMacs (until they're G4 - MacWorld Tokyo?). New G4s (667 and 733) have 4 Altivec units, compared to 2 in old G4s, so iDVD should really scream in these.

iDVD2 only works on a G4 with an _internal_ DVD-R.
So if you buy one... you need to install it internally for it to work with iDVD2.
